What are 2D Shapes?
Two-dimensional (2D) shapes are flat shapes that can be drawn on a piece of paper. They have only two dimensions: length and width. Examples of 2D shapes include:
- Squares
- Rectangles
- Triangles
- Circles
- Hexagons
- Octagons
Properties of 2D Shapes
2D shapes have several properties that distinguish them from one another. These properties include:
Number of Sides
- A square has 4 sides
- A rectangle has 4 sides
- A triangle has 3 sides
- A circle has no sides (it's a continuous curve)
Number of Corners
- A square has 4 corners
- A rectangle has 4 corners
- A triangle has 3 corners
- A circle has no corners
Angles
- A square has 4 right angles (90 degrees each)
- A rectangle has 4 right angles (90 degrees each)
- A triangle has 3 angles (sum of angles is 180 degrees)
- A circle has no angles
What are 3D Shapes?
Three-dimensional (3D) shapes are solid shapes that occupy space. They have three dimensions: length, width, and height. Examples of 3D shapes include:
- Cubes
- Rectangular prisms
- Triangular prisms
- Spheres
- Cones
- Cylinders
Properties of 3D Shapes
3D shapes have several properties that distinguish them from one another. These properties include:
Number of Faces
- A cube has 6 faces
- A rectangular prism has 6 faces
- A triangular prism has 5 faces
- A sphere has 1 face (a continuous curved surface)
Number of Edges
- A cube has 12 edges
- A rectangular prism has 12 edges
- A triangular prism has 9 edges
- A sphere has no edges
Number of Vertices (Corners)
- A cube has 8 vertices
- A rectangular prism has 8 vertices
- A triangular prism has 6 vertices
- A sphere has no vertices
